About this school

Engayne Primary School is a community school mixed primary school located in Havering, London (RM14 1SW). It has 587 pupils and a capacity of 600.

In its most recent Ofsted inspection in December 2014, Engayne Primary School was rated Good — a school that meets the high standards set by Ofsted and provides a sound education. The full inspection report is available on the Ofsted website.

At Key Stage 2, 67% of pupils at Engayne Primary School met the expected standard in Reading, Writing and Maths combined — in line with the national average of approximately 65%. 4% achieved the higher standard. The three-year rolling average is 64%, which gives a more stable picture of the school's typical performance.

The school serves a diverse community: a relatively low proportion of pupils (7.5%) are eligible for Free School Meals, a measure of socioeconomic deprivation, and 18% speak English as an additional language. Havering is a London borough with a varied demographic profile.
